Common Terminology for Car Brands
In English, car brands are commonly referred to as “car makes” or “automobile manufacturers.” The term “car make” is used to describe the specific brand or company that produces a particular vehicle. For example:
1. “Toyota is a well-known car make from Japan.”
2. “Mercedes-Benz is a luxury car make.”
The term “automobile manufacturer” is a broader term that encompasses all companies involved in the production of automobiles. It includes both car makes and companies that produce various car makes. For instance:
1. “General Motors is one of the largest automobile manufacturers in the world.”
2. “Ford is an American automobile manufacturer.”

Important Considerations
When referring to car brands, it is essential to use the correct capitalization and punctuation. Car makes are typically capitalized, while the word “car” is not. For example:
1. Correct: “I own a Toyota car.”
Incorrect: “I own a toyota car.”
Additionally, it is important to note that some car brands have specific naming conventions. For instance, BMW stands for Bayerische Motoren Werke, and Mercedes-Benz uses a hyphenated name. Therefore, it is crucial to use the correct spelling and formatting for each brand.
